PAS Users > Ask Mike > Dear Agency Seeker... Dear Mike, I live in Chula Vista, California with my mentally challenged son and I'm having trouble finding an agency that has PAS. Is there a central agency in California or is there one in San Diego County where I can apply at to get service for him, any feedback would be helpful. Signed, Agency Seeker Dear Agency Seeker, I have some contact information for you that I hope you find useful. Before I get to that, however, I would like to take the liberty of providing some basic background about home and community services and supports for individuals with cognitive and/or intellectual disabilities and their families. These are my thoughts about what appears to be available in California. It looks like the services you are interested in are available through a Medicaid Waiver. Medicaid is basically a health insurance program for people that are poor. Medicaid also covers long term services and supports (care) in institutions and facilities as well as home and community services and supports. The home and community services and supports are usually provided through what are called "Waivers". Basically, these Waivers are home and community services that are provided as alternatives to institutional/facility based services. A person must qualify and meet the level of need for the institution/facility and then choose the home and community option, if available. This is a confusing, fragmented system, but, again, the basics are that a person must be "severe" enough to enter an institution and also financially poor to qualify for any assistance. It looks like you are looking for home and community assistance as opposed to having your son enter an institution so, keeping the two basic eligibility criteria in mind (financial and severity of condition or disability) you should check out your state Medicaid agency, in particular your state's "Developmental Disability" (DD) Waiver. This information is available on the PAS Center's web site Medical Waiver pages. Check out also the agencies related to PAS web pages as well as getting the Medicaid and DD agency contact information. If need be, the centers for independent living (ILC) and Protection and Advocacy (P&A) agencies may be able to help you with other information and resources including advocacy and/or appeals if the unfortunate happenstance occurs and you need this kind of assistance!
